California’s biotechnology sector encompasses a wide range of disciplines, including genetics, molecular biology, biochemistry, and pharmaceuticals. The state is home to numerous biotech companies that are at the forefront of developing cutting-edge technologies and therapies. From improving crop yields and creating sustainable biofuels to developing new treatments for cancer and other diseases, biotech companies in California are making significant contributions to society.
One of the key factors driving the growth of the biotechnology industry in California is the state’s highly skilled workforce. California is home to some of the top academic and research institutions in the world, such as Stanford University, University of California, Berkeley, and California Institute of Technology. These institutions provide a steady stream of talented individuals who are well-versed in the latest research and technology trends, making California an attractive destination for biotech companies looking to recruit top talent.
Furthermore, California’s strong regulatory framework and supportive business environment have also contributed to the success of the biotechnology industry in the state. The California Department of Food and Agriculture, the California Department of Public Health, and other government agencies play a vital role in regulating and overseeing biotech activities to ensure consumer safety and environmental protection. This regulatory oversight helps to build trust and credibility in the industry, which is essential for attracting investment and fostering growth.
In addition to its robust regulatory framework, California also offers a variety of financial incentives and resources to support biotech companies. The state has a number of grant programs, tax credits, and other financial assistance initiatives aimed at promoting innovation and entrepreneurship in the biotechnology sector. Additionally, California’s network of incubators, accelerators, and venture capital firms provide startups and established companies with the support they need to develop and commercialize their products and solutions.
California’s biotechnology industry is diverse and dynamic, with companies of all sizes and specialties contributing to its growth and success. From small startups focusing on niche markets to established multinational corporations with global operations, the state’s biotech ecosystem is a melting pot of innovation and collaboration. Companies like Genentech, Gilead Sciences, and Amgen are just a few examples of the industry leaders that call California home.
